## WaveGlance Build Provenance

Hey reviewer — quick rundown on how WaveGlance (our audio waveform preview widget at Tidepool Labs) gets built. Everything goes through the Copperline pipeline: source checkout, pinned dependencies, reproducible build flags, then signing. No human hands touch the artifact between compile and publish, which should make your audit easier. Each release bundle embeds its provenance manifest, and the canonical way to tie a deployed widget back to its pipeline run is the token below.

pipeline stamp: htk9_ce63042d9

First-day checklist — Item 7: Show the new starter the first-aid room on Level 2, beside the print hub at Millbrook House. Point out the defibrillator cabinet, the eyewash station, and the list of trained first aiders pinned inside the door. The room stays locked outside core hours, so make sure they know where to find it before any incident. The keypad entry code is noted below.

badge for fafop-fajof: bdg-Z-47

# Welcome to HallEcho Support

HallEcho is the audio-guide app used by the Verrowfield Museum and a handful of smaller galleries. Most tickets are about downloads stalling on gallery Wi-Fi or tours not matching room numbers after an exhibit moves — there's a macro for each, promise. For escalations involving the content pipeline, you'll sometimes need to confirm a build is genuine before telling the curator team to re-publish. Check its signature against the key that follows.

release key, hahig-tahop: bky9_M2QMJ6LkR